Great Success for Condensed Matter Science in Dresden and Würzburg!

Complexity, Topology and Dynamics in Quantum Materials – ctd.qmat
We are thrilled to announce that our Cluster of Excellence ct.qmat—a joint initiative between TU Dresden and the University of Würzburg—will continue for a second funding period!
Following an extremely successful first phase from 2019 to 2025, which led to numerous groundbreaking discoveries in the field of quantum materials, our cluster has been renewed and will now enter its next chapter under the new name ctd.qmat. The acronym stands for Complexity, Topology and Dynamics in Quantum Materials, reflecting an expanded scientific vision that builds on the strong foundation laid over the past years.
